Cycle Talk SA: Cherise Stander speaks about her difficulties getting back on the bike after Burry’s death

By BikeHubCoreAdmin · 0 comments

This week Cycle Talk SA caught up with Cherise Stander, wife of the late Burry Stander who has teamed up with the Pedal Power Association to help raise awareness about their Ride 4 Your Life campaign.

ccs-41808-0-87411100-1379583434.jpgImage credit: Kyle Gilham – Gameplan Media

Cherise told Brad at Cycle Talk SA about the ride they have undertaken from Johannesburg to Cape Town and what they hope to achieve in doing so. Cherise also gave a brutally honest account about how hard it is for her to get on the bike since Burry was killed in January this year.

Radio and TV personality Liezel van der Westhuizen, who is training for the Coronation Double Century, also spoke to Brad this week about some of the challenges she has had to overcome. Brad also asked her if she was going to be stuck on a tandem, who she would want to be stuck with. Who would you want to be stuck on a tandem with?
